Before exploring mobile clinics for sale, the first step is identifying the specific services you plan to offer. According to Dr. Susan Miller, a consultant for mobile health services, "Understanding your target demographic and the type of care you wish to provide will help narrow down your options significantly." Knowing whether you need a clinic for vaccinations, maternal care, or general health exams will dictate the type of mobile unit you should pursue.
Financial planning is essential when looking into mobile clinics for sale. Industry expert Mark Thompson emphasizes, "It's crucial to account for not just the purchase price but also ongoing operational costs." Factor in maintenance, insurance, and staffing to create a realistic budget that covers the complete expense of running a mobile clinic.
Understanding who manufactures the mobile clinics is another imperative step. Experienced buyer Samantha Phelps advises, "Read reviews and speak to peers to get insights on reliable manufacturers. A well-known brand typically provides better support and service." A reputable manufacturer can make a significant difference in service longevity and reliability.
As you inspect mobile clinics for sale, pay close attention to the build quality. Engineer Carlos Ramirez points out, "A sturdy chassis and high-quality materials will ensure the vehicle can withstand regular use and various environmental conditions." Look for models that emphasize durability and ease of maintenance.
Mobile clinics must adhere to specific health and safety regulations. Compliance specialist Julia Wong asserts, "Make sure any unit you are considering meets local health codes and regulations." Failing to ensure compliance can lead to costly delays and fines down the line.

Many mobile clinics for sale offer customization features. According to designer Bill Carton, "Tailoring your mobile clinic to suit your specific needs—such as the layout, equipment, and design—can vastly improve operational efficiency." Explore options for customizing the interior based on your services.
In an ever-evolving digital world, technology integration is crucial. Tech analyst Jane Murphy suggests, "Look for clinics that come equipped with telehealth capabilities, electronic health record systems, and other tech enhancements that can streamline your services." This will ensure your mobile clinic remains competitive and efficient.
The mobility of the clinic is paramount. Transportation expert Ryan Ford notes, "Evaluate how easy it is to drive and set up the clinic. A mobile unit that is difficult to maneuver can hinder service delivery." Ensure the mobile clinic is user-friendly to maximize its effectiveness.
Storage can often be overlooked when purchasing mobile clinics for sale. Nurse practitioner Emily Sanders states, "Consider where you'll store medical supplies, equipment, and patient records. Adequate storage solutions can greatly enhance your operational capabilities." A well-organized space is essential for smooth operations.
Finally, always ask for a demonstration or a tour of the mobile clinic. Sales director Gary Lopez recommends, "Seeing the unit in action allows you to assess its features, usability, and functionality before making a commitment." Experiencing the clinic firsthand can provide insights that online research cannot.
